WebChildhood schizophrenia causes symptoms similar to schizophrenia in adults. In many cases, children who have schizophrenia first show social and developmental delays that occur with other conditions, including: Disorganized behaviors, including inappropriate outbursts. Motor skill delays, including a delay in learning to walk.

This guideline covers the treatment and management of psychosis and schizophrenia and related disorders in adults (18 years and older) with onset before 60 years. The term 'psychosis' is used in this guideline to refer to the group of psychotic disorders that includes schizophrenia, schizoaffective disorder, … gin distillery st leonardsWebJan 23, 2024 · For example, women may exhibit depression or anxiety which may put them at a higher risk for suicide.².
